FAQ – NYC Accounting & Audit

Hire a CPA during formation or before your first tax season. An auditor is crucial when seeking funding, preparing for grants, or complying with nonprofit/state requirements.

CPAs often offer flat fees for bookkeeping and tax prep; audits and financial statements are billed hourly or per engagement.

Mandatory when filing for government contracts, grants, or meeting nonprofit revenue thresholds—or when investor-grade financials are necessary.

Ask if they specialize in startup equity, audits, R&D credits, multi-state filings, and compliance with regulators like the NY Attorney General or SEC oversight.
